Conversão de HTML para PNG com Aspose.HTML para Java

No mundo do desenvolvimento web, a capacidade de converter conteúdo HTML para outros formatos costuma ser uma tarefa crucial. Um requisito comum é transformar HTML em um formato de imagem como PNG. Aspose.HTML for Java fornece uma solução poderosa para realizar essa tarefa com facilidade. Neste tutorial passo a passo, iremos guiá-lo através do processo de conversão de HTML em PNG usando Aspose.HTML para Java.

Pré-requisitos

Antes de começarmos com o processo de conversão real, certifique-se de ter os seguintes pré-requisitos em vigor:

  • Ambiente de Desenvolvimento Java: Certifique-se de ter um ambiente de desenvolvimento Java configurado em seu sistema.

  • Aspose.HTML para Java: você deve ter a biblioteca Aspose.HTML para Java instalada. Você pode baixá-lo noDocumentação Aspose.HTML para Java.

  • Conteúdo HTML: Prepare o conteúdo HTML que deseja converter em uma imagem PNG.

  • Conhecimento básico de Java: você deve ter um conhecimento básico de programação Java.

Importar pacotes

Em seu projeto Java, você precisa importar os pacotes necessários do Aspose.HTML for Java para realizar a conversão de HTML em PNG. Veja como você pode importar os pacotes necessários:

import com.aspose.html.HTMLDocument;
import com.aspose.html.saving.ImageSaveOptions;
import com.aspose.html.converters.Converter;
import com.aspose.html.rendering.image.ImageFormat;

Prepare o conteúdo HTML

Para começar, você deve preparar o conteúdo HTML que deseja converter em uma imagem PNG. Você pode usar qualquer código HTML conforme suas necessidades.

String htmlCode = "<span>Hello</span> <span>World!!</span>";

Você pode salvar esse código HTML em um arquivo para processamento posterior. Neste exemplo, estamos salvando-o em um arquivo chamado “document.html”.

try (java.io.FileWriter fileWriter = new java.io.FileWriter("document.html")) {
    fileWriter.write(htmlCode);
}

Inicialize um documento HTML

Em seguida, você precisa inicializar um documento HTML a partir do arquivo HTML criado na etapa anterior.

HTMLDocument document = new HTMLDocument("document.html");

Converter HTML em PNG

Agora é hora de configurar as opções de conversão e realizar a conversão de HTML para PNG.

ImageSaveOptions options = new ImageSaveOptions(ImageFormat.Png);
Converter.convertHTML(document, options, "output.png");

Limpar

Não se esqueça de liberar quaisquer recursos e limpar após a conclusão da conversão.

if (document != null) {
    document.dispose();
}

Parabéns! Você converteu HTML em PNG com sucesso usando Aspose.HTML para Java. Agora você pode usar a imagem PNG gerada conforme necessário em seus projetos.

Conclusão

Neste tutorial, demonstramos como usar Aspose.HTML for Java para converter HTML em PNG. Com as etapas e trechos de código fornecidos, você poderá incorporar facilmente essa funcionalidade em seus aplicativos Java.

Perguntas frequentes

Onde posso encontrar a documentação do Aspose.HTML para Java?

Você pode encontrar a documentação em[Aspose.HTML para documentação Java](https://reference.aspose.com/html/java/).

Como posso baixar Aspose.HTML para Java?

Você pode baixá-lo no site:[Baixe Aspose.HTML para Java](https://releases.aspose.com/html/java/).

Existe uma avaliação gratuita disponível para Aspose.HTML para Java?

Sim, você pode obter um teste gratuito em[Avaliação gratuita do Aspose.HTML](https://releases.aspose.com/).

Como obtenho uma licença temporária do Aspose.HTML para Java?

Você pode solicitar uma licença temporária de[Licença temporária Aspose.HTML](https://purchase.aspose.com/temporary-license/).

Onde posso obter suporte da comunidade e fazer perguntas sobre o Aspose.HTML for Java?

Você pode participar da discussão da comunidade em[Fórum de suporte Aspose.HTML](https://forum.aspose.com/).